




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、目录目录1摘要1前言3第一章概要41.1开发背景41.2系统的目标和意义41.3人力资源管理系统的发展趋势51.4可行性分析5第二章技术背景62.1 ASP.NET概述62.2 ASP.NET开发的硬件和软件要求72.3系统的开发方法、开发工具及其语言特征.第三章系统需求分析和概要设计93.1系统需求分析93.2系统功能说明93.3功能模块分类93.4系统的概要设计103.5数据表的建立14第四章系统详细设计164.1管理员的设计164.1.1管理员登录页面如图4-1所示: 164.1.2用户管理184.1.3添加用户204.1.4公告管理.21加上4.1.5公告.234.2部门经理的设计23
2、4.2.1对本部门员工进行工作管理244.2.2工作人员薪金模块25第五章系统测试255.1软件测试的方法265.2模块测试27第六章总结27谢礼29参考文献30摘要人才管理系统是现在公司的好辅助工具,为企业的发展提供了很大的便利。本系统使用ASP.NET开发工具创建Web应用程序。 使用C#开发语言,使用SQL Server2008数据库访问技术和三层体系结构,提供人才信息的便利管理。 它基本上满足了人力资源管理员和员工的功能需求,对员工的工资、工作等实现了比较详细的功能,从杂乱的东西中解放出来,彻底解决了浪费时间和工作量的问题,提高了企业整体工作效率,注册后设定权限,提高了系统的安全性,人
3、事信息的安全性关键词:人力资源管理系统、ASP.NET、C#、SQL Server2008数据库访问技术、三层体系结构、人力资源管理员、安全A开发工具forcreationwebapplications.using c# 开发语言使用SQL server 2008 databaseccesstraccetechnolleandconnentitionmanagementionof
4、prothedetabasert callymeettheneee ementandemployeesonthefunctionofdemand,to staff salary atentdandershatedfencementityformyriadofsthefree,complementitythewasteof 日志权限设置,improve the security of the system,enserverthesauteofsuppronentinformationnetworksociety, toadattoenterprisedeprovementrequirements
5、,totheenterprisesystemconstructionsisofgreatcertificatence。keywords : thepersonnelmanagement; PS;PS; C#; SQL server 2008树层体系结构; Personnel manager; safety前言人的智慧和力量是无限的,社会的发展和科学的进步越来越强调人才的重要性,有利用计算机实现人才管理的倾向。对大中小企业来说,利用计算机完成人力资源管理部分是使企业劳动人事管理科学化、规范化的必要条件,但公司各部门的调整、工资结算、支付工作量大,且不允许出错。 手工制作大量表格不仅容易混乱、不容
6、易管理,而且还需要大量的员工时间和精力。 如果利用计算机进行管理,不仅能保证正确性,还能为财务部门和公司的主要管理者提供信息服务。 计算机具有存储容量大、机密性低、成本低、检索快捷、检索方便、寿命长等特征,显得更方便、管理方便。 这些优点都大幅度提高了人力资源管理的效率,为企业的科学化、规范化管理和世界的联系提供了重要条件。 因此,结合中小企业的发展现状和人力资源管理工作的实际需要,设计开发了基于. NET的人力资源管理系统。第一章的概要1.1开发背景管理信息系统(MIS )由人、计算机等构成,是能够收集、传递、存储、维护和使用信息的系统。 管理信息系统是信息系统的分支之一,经过30多年的发展
7、,已经成为具有自己的概念、理论、结构、体系和开发方法的集中管理科学、信息科学、系统科学和计算机科学等垄断多学科的综合学科。管理信息系统的结构通常由信息源、信息管理器、信息用户和信息管理器四个部门组成。 管理信息系统的主要任务一般实现基础数据的严格管理,确定信息处理流程的标准化,有效完成日常处理工作,优化分配人才、物资、财力等各种资源。 MIS是人机结合的辅助管理系统,管理和决策的主题是人,计算机是辅助设备。目前国内使用和发展的MIS平台模型大致分为客户端/服务器(Client/Server,C/S )模型和Web浏览器/服务器(Browser/Server,B/S )模型。 目前,虽然企业信息
8、管理系统已从C/S结构转变为B/S结构,但在安全性等方面,C/S结构的管理信息系统仍然是企业管理信息系统的主流。1.2系统的目标和意义可以给企业带来先进的管理思想和方法,促进现代人才管理模式的建立,促进人才管理规范化,帮助企业管理实效的提高,帮助企业管理成本的降低。所有管理的目标都是为了利益。 在计划经济时代,传统的用人制度忽视了人才管理的开发和管理问题,缺乏人才管理的理念和认识,忽视了人才的资源性、整体性等特征。 在市场经济和知识经济时代,人力资源管理要实现与社会主义计划经济相适应的人力资源管理体制和社会主义市场经济体制相协调的人力资源管理体制,重视人才的资源性和人力资本的计算和认识,确立以
9、人为中心的思想,强调以人为资源和资本的整体人力资源管理体系的开发。现在市场上流行的人才管理系统不在少数。 但是,企业事业单位的人才管理系统不需要大型的数据库系统。 操作简单,功能实用,只需要一个能满足本中心数据管理和需要的系统。 我们的目标是开发功能实用、操作简单、易懂的人才管理系统。该系统的具体任务是设计企业的员工信息管理系统,代替计算机手动执行新增员工信息、修改员工信息、删除退休人员信息等一系列操作。 这使员工可以轻松快捷地完成员工信息管理任务,使企业员工管理工作系统化、规范化、自动化,提高企业管理的效率。设计指导思想都是为用户考虑的,界面美观,操作尽可能简单,作为一个实用的应用程序具有良
10、好的可接受性,在用户错误操作时尽快发出警告,让用户能及时修改。 支持企业标准化管理。 支持企业高效的劳动人事管理的日常业务包括新员工加入时的人事资料的制作、旧员工的调动、退休、退休等。 协助企业做好劳动人力资源管理及其相关方面的科学决策。人才管理体系是现代企业管理不可或缺的一部分,是适应现代企业制度的要求,推进企业劳动人事管理科学化、规范化的必要条件。1.3人力资源管理系统的发展趋势(一)世界趋势人才管理体系主导了21世纪,无论是发达国家还是发展中国家,都开始深刻理解人才的战略意义并付诸行动。 这种情况的变化是由竞争压力引起的。 现在,世纪经济正在走向全球化。 世纪经济全球化过程和国家开放过程
11、要求组织管理部门降低管理成本,降低竞争压力,增强竞争力。 不同的组织,人工费占总成本的比例不同。(2)技术革新无论现在还是将来,工业的发展都依赖科学和技术、知识和技能。 这不仅是员工,特别是技术人员掌握信息的科学知识和技术能力,更重要的是员工深入、迅速地掌握和应用这些知识和技能。 这会引起两个问题。 第一,随着这种技术革新的发展和知识更新速度的加快,人们有更多的择业机会。 第二,随着这种发展和择业机会的增加,人力资源管理活动和频率加剧,而且这项活动对科学技术的要求及其反应度也提高了,提高了人力资源的成本。 因此,人力资源管理很有帮助。1.4可行性分析(1)社会可行性分析随着计算机的发展和普及和
12、网络技术的扩大,日常的人力资源管理实现无纸化事务,加入公司内的内部网和网络,实现数据共享,有利于人力资源信息在公司内的查询,提高数据资源的利用,及时更新(2)技术可行性分析Visual Studio 2008提供了一个集成、紧密集成的可视化编程环境,简化了应用程序开发过程,并缩短了实用方法的时间。 Visual Studio.NET可以轻松地创建具有自动扩展功能的可靠应用程序和组件。 并且微软卓越的成果C#语言保持着C/C特有的强大功能和控制能力。 c和熟悉的模型和语法具有COM服务和完全的交互性和完全的支持能力,可以轻松迁移现有代码。 数据库SQL2008可以满足中小企业的数据要求,有些大企
13、业可以实现。 现在,计算机的普及度越来越广,计算机的配置日新月异,能搭载这个系统的机器,例如办公室的机器都可以满足要求。 因此,本系统具有技术可行性。(3)经济可行性分析如果采用传统的手工输入方法,不仅工作复杂,而且人工输入多,记录容易错误,那样会产生成本高、效果差的弊病,建立企业数据库非常困难和麻烦。 采用这种系统的成本,劳力远远低于手工作业,实用方便,更新也简单,只需按部门一个人管理,就能对企业无纸化发挥很大作用。 也有该系统的经济可行性。(4)管理可行性分析本系统采用了系统数据的备份、恢复等功能,接口级别清晰,在设计方面增加了人性化的要素。 管理这个系统不是简单的,容易学。第二章技术背景
14、2.1 ASP.NET概述ASP.NET是M的一部分,作为一种战略产品,它不仅包括以下版本的Active Server Page(ASP ),还包括开发人员生成企业级Web应用程序所需的服务ASP.NET语法与ASP很大兼容,同时提供了新的编程模型和结构,生成可扩展性和稳定性高的应用程序,并提供更好的安全性。 通过向现有的ASP应用程序中添加ASP.NET功能,可以随时扩展ASP应用程序的功能。ASP.NET是一个基于. NET的编译环境,可以用任何与. NET兼容的语言(包括Visual Basic.NET、C#和Jscript.NET )创建应用程序。 此外,任何A
15、SP.NET应用程序都可以使用整个. net框架。 开发者可以很容易地得到这些技术的优点。 例如,主机公共语言的执行库环境、类型的安全性、继承等。ASP.NET与WYSIWYG HTML编辑器和Microsoft Visual Studio.NET等编程工具无缝地工作。 这不仅使Web开发变得容易,还提供了开发人员可以将服务器控件拖放到网页上的GUI和完全集成的调试支持等这些工具必须提供的所有优点。ASP.NET提供了稳定的性能、卓越的升级能力、更快的开发、更简单的管理、新的语言和web服务。 整个ASP.NET的主题是帮助系统对用户不重要的大部分琐事。StringBuilder .Append (你好! 等,系统通过StringBuilder类将数据写入了网站页面); response.Write(sb.ToString (); “你好! ”可以在后台直接写在页面上的是,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 心血管内科护理服务优化带教计划
- 企业英语培训教研组计划
- 北师大版小学五年级数学习题演练计划
- 新闻记者职业生涯访谈报告格式范文
- 二手交易电商平台信用体系建设与消费者满意度提升策略研究报告
- 城市轨道交通施工机械设备投入计划
- 2025青年教师师德师风自我提升心得体会
- 家校共育中家长参与线上平台心得体会
- 医疗机构疫情防控存在的问题及整改措施
- 汽车零部件再制造产业政策环境分析及未来发展预测报告
- 远大住工-装配式建筑发展现状和技术标准
- esd静电测试报告
- 四川省专业技术人员继续教育2023年公需课试题及答案
- 煤气取样安全操作规程
- 人形机器人行业:人形机器人供应链梳理
- 北京市高考语文名著阅读《红楼梦》试题(附解析)
- GB/T 27622-2011畜禽粪便贮存设施设计要求
- 急性胃肠炎的护理查房
- 第一章-护理学基础绪论
- 烟花爆竹经营单位安全管理人员培训教材课件
- 装修改造工程施工现场总平面布置
评论
0/150
提交评论